Game Over

Game Over by Carlyn Parent Pac Man, bright like a cartoon sun, advances to level three. Scooting his way through the flashing entrance, he encounters a bundle of bananas. Pac Man accepts without knowledge of its dangers. The initial fruit energy is not enough to conquer the ongoing maze. Pac Man, too young for such perils, becomes dizzy, bouncing off walls, hurting himself and those around him. The blue ghost attacks, consuming Pac Man. Points are nonchalantly subtracted from his already-short life. The hypnotic game would not occur if men learned to refuse the bundle of bananas. It is poisoned with alcohol.
